#20fc50 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#20fc50 is composed of 12.5% red, 98.8%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.3%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 133.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 55.7%. #20fc50 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ffa0 with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#20fc50

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000902 is the darkest color, while #f5f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#20fc50

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88948b is the less saturated color, while #20fc50 is the most saturated one.
